LEMON PEPPER SALMON



Lemon Pepper Salmon image

Perfect Lemon Pepper Salmon in foil is the best way to bake salmon in the oven. This easy recipe is FOOLPROOF, healthy, and ready in 30 minutes.

2 pound side of salmon (boneless (skin on or off, depending upon your preference) wild caught if possible)
10 sprigs of fresh thyme (optional, but delicious)
2 medium lemons (plus additional for serving)
2 tablespoons extra virgin olive oil
1 teaspoon kosher salt
1/2 teaspoon freshly ground black pepper (plus additional to taste)
finely chopped fresh herbs of choice ((I prefer parsley or basil))

Steps:

  • Remove the salmon from the refrigerator, and let stand at room temperature for 10 minutes while you prepare the other ingredients. Heat oven to 375 degrees F. Line a rimmed baking sheet large enough to hold your piece of salmon with a large piece of aluminum foil. If you prefer the salmon not to touch the foil, lay a sheet of parchment paper on top.
  • Lightly coat the foil with baking spay, then arrange 5 sprigs of the thyme down the middle. Cut one of the lemons into thin slices and arrange half of the slices down the middle too. Place the salmon on top.
  • Drizzle the salmon with the olive oil. Zest the second lemon over the salmon and sprinkle with the salt and pepper. Lay the remaining thyme and lemon slices on top of the salmon. Juice the zested lemon, then pour the juice over the top.
  • Fold the sides of the aluminum foil up and over the top of the salmon until it is completely enclosed. If your piece of foil is not large enough, place a second piece on top and fold the edges under so that it forms a sealed packet. Leave a little room inside the foil for air to circulate.
  • Bake the salmon for 18-21 minutes, until the salmon is almost completely cooked through at the thickest part. The cooking time will vary based on the thickness of your salmon. If your side is thinner (around 1-inch thick) check several minutes early to ensure your salmon does not overcook. If your piece is very thick (1 1/2 inches or more), it may need longer.
  • Remove the salmon from the oven, and carefully open the foil so that the top of the fish is completely uncovered (be careful of hot steam). Change the oven setting to broil, then return the fish to the oven and broil for 3 minutes, until the top of the salmon is slightly golden and the fish is cooked through completely. Watch the salmon closely as it broils to make sure it doesn't overcook. Remove the salmon from the oven. If it still appears a bit underdone, you can wrap the foil back over the top and let it rest for a few minutes. Do not let it sit too long-salmon can progress from "not done" to "over done" very quickly. As soon as it flakes easily with a fork, it's ready.
  • To serve, cut the salmon into portions. Sprinkle with additional fresh herbs or top with an extra squeeze of lemon as desired.

Nutrition Facts : ServingSize 1 (of 6), about 6 ounces each, Calories 268 kcal, Carbohydrate 4 g, Protein 31 g, Fat 14 g, SaturatedFat 2 g, Cholesterol 83 mg, Fiber 1 g, Sugar 1 g

SALMON WITH FRUIT SALSA



Salmon with Fruit Salsa image

Baked salmon and fruit salsa with a spicy kick. Serve over rice.

1 pound salmon steaks
1 lemon, juiced
1 tablespoon chopped fresh rosemary
salt and pepper to taste
1 lemon, sliced
⅓ cup water
¼ cup diced fresh pineapple
¼ cup minced onion
3 cloves garlic, minced
2 fresh jalapeno peppers, diced
1 tomato, diced
½ cup pineapple juice
¼ cup diced red bell pepper
¼ cup diced yellow bell pepper

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C).
  • Arrange salmon steaks in a shallow baking dish, and coat with the lemon juice. Season with rosemary, salt, and pepper. Top with lemon slices. Pour water into the dish.
  • Bake for 30 to 40 minutes in the preheated oven, or until easily flaked with a fork.
  • In a medium bowl, mix pineapple, onion, garlic, jalapeno, tomato, pineapple juice, red bell pepper, and yellow bell pepper. Cover, and refrigerate while fish is baking. Top fish with salsa to serve.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 216.5 calories, Carbohydrate 15.7 g, Cholesterol 50.4 mg, Fat 7 g, Fiber 3.9 g, Protein 25.9 g, SaturatedFat 1.5 g, Sodium 198.3 mg, Sugar 6.2 g

SALT AND PEPPER SALMON

1 salmon fillet (about 2 pounds), skin on, 1 1/2 to 2 inches thick
Kosher salt
Extra-virgin olive oil
Freshly ground black pepper
6 tablespoons unsalted butter, room temperature
Smashed New Potatoes with Peas, Lemon, and Pearl Onions, recipe follows
1 1/2 to 2 pounds red bliss potatoes
Kosher salt and freshly ground black pepper
Extra-virgin olive oil
3 tablespoons unsalted butter
One 10-ounce box frozen pearl onions, defrosted
Pinch sugar
Splash freshly squeezed lemon juice
5 slices lemon
Two 10-ounce boxes frozen peas, defrosted
1 lemon, zested
1/4 cup roughly chopped flat-leaf parsley
2 heaping tablespoons roughly chopped fresh dill
1 bunch watercress, stems trimmed just above the rubber band

Steps:

  • Run your finger up and down the center of the salmon feeling for any pin bones. Remove any that you find with a needle-nosed pliers or tweezers. With a sharp knife cutting across the width of the salmon, divide it into 4 equal portions. Lightly salt the salmon and let sit a couple minutes; this will help you get crispy skin.
  • Heat a 2-count, about 2 tablespoons, of olive oil in a large skillet over medium-high heat until the oil is almost smoking. Season the salmon with pepper, and rub about 1 1/2 tablespoons butter on the skin side of each fillet. Add the salmon to the pan, skin-side down. To get super crispy skin, cook the salmon almost to completion, about 6 minutes.
  • Flip the salmon and cook until flesh side is nicely seared, 1 to 2 minutes.
  • Transfer the salmon to a platter and serve with the Smashed Potatoes.
  • Put the potatoes into a large pot, cover them with cold water, and add a large pinch of salt. If they're large, cut them in half. Bring to a boil and simmer until the potatoes are fork tender, 20 to 30 minutes. Drain. Stick a fork into the potatoes, 1 at a time, lift them out of the colander and peel with a paring knife. Toss the potatoes into a bowl and roughly crush them. Drizzle with olive oil and season with salt and pepper.
  • Heat 2 tablespoons olive oil with the butter in a medium saucepan over medium heat until the butter melts. Add the pearl onions, sugar, and lemon juice and cook, stirring frequently, until the onions are browned, 5 to 6 minutes. Add the lemon slices, peas, and lemon zest and continue cooking until the peas are hot. Season with salt and pepper. Dump the vegetables over the potatoes in the bowl, drizzle with extra-virgin olive oil add the parsley and dill and taste for salt and pepper. Scatter the watercress over the top, fold it in just until it wilts and call it a day.

SALMON WITH FRUIT AND PEPPERS

2 lbs salmon fillets
2 lemons, juice of
1 medium orange, sectioned and seeded
1 medium onion, thinly sliced
1 small red bell pepper, julienned
1 small green bell pepper, julienned
1 pint strawberry, sliced
1/2 cup water
1/2 cup liquid honey
1/2 cup chopped fresh chervil (or fresh dill if you can't find chervil)
4 garlic cloves, minced
1 bunch chives, chopped

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 350F; line a baking sheet with foil.
  • Place salmon fillet on foil-lined pan and season to taste with salt, pepper and garlic powder. Cover fish with orange sections and sliced onions; scatter pepper slices around the salmon.
  • In a mixing bowl, combine the sliced strawberries, water, honey, chervil, garlic and chives; pour mixture evenly over the fish.
  • Cover baking sheet tightly with a piece of foil and make a couple of small piercings to let a bit of the steam escape.
  • Bake in preheated oven for 25 to 30 minutes.

SHEET PAN SALMON AND BELL PEPPER DINNER



Sheet Pan Salmon and Bell Pepper Dinner image

An easy recipe for a quick dinner for weeknights with salmon, bell peppers, parsley, and lemon that is ready in about 30 minutes. I usually serve it with rice.

2 tablespoons olive oil
4 (3 ounce) fillets salmon fillets
2 red bell peppers, chopped
1 yellow bell pepper, chopped
1 onion, sliced
6 tablespoons lemon juice
3 tablespoons olive oil
2 tablespoons water
1 tablespoon maple syrup
5 cloves garlic
1 ½ teaspoons salt
1 ½ teaspoons red pepper flakes
1 teaspoon ground cumin
½ bunch fresh parsley, chopped
1 lemon, sliced

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 400 degrees F (200 degrees C). Grease a sheet pan with 2 tablespoons olive oil.
  • Place salmon fillets, red and yellow bell peppers, and onion on the prepared sheet pan.
  • Combine lemon juice, 3 tablespoons olive oil, water, maple syrup, garlic, salt, red pepper flakes, cumin, and parsley in a small bowl. Drizzle 2/3 of the sauce over the ingredients on the sheet pan.
  • Bake in the preheated oven until salmon is cooked through and flakes easily with a fork, 10 to 15 minutes.
  • Serve with lemon slices and remaining sauce.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 337.1 calories, Carbohydrate 16.9 g, Cholesterol 47 mg, Fat 22.9 g, Fiber 3.7 g, Protein 18.8 g, SaturatedFat 3.3 g, Sodium 920.7 mg, Sugar 7.3 g

ROAST PEPPER & SALMON PLATTER



Roast pepper & salmon platter image

The perfect alfresco salad. Warm new potatoes, roasted peppers and salmon, mixed with the punchy flavours of capers and anchovies

5 large red peppers , halved and seeded
3 tbsp extra-virgin olive oil , plus extra for the peppers
4 salmon fillets , skin on
3 tbsp pine nut
500g pack small new potato
1 tbsp balsamic vinegar
85g marinated anchovy
2 tbsp caper , rinsed
20g pack basil , torn or shredded
2 handfuls rocket

Steps:

  • 1 Heat oven to 220C/200C fan/gas 7. Rub the peppers with a little oil, then place, skin side up, in a large roasting tin. Roast for 15 mins, then add the salmon to the tin, skin side down. Scatter over the pine nuts and return to the oven for 10 mins more.
  • Meanwhile, boil the potatoes in their skins for 8-10 mins until tender, then thickly slice or halve. Mix the oil and vinegar in a large bowl and add the anchovies and capers. When the peppers are cool enough to handle, strip off the skins and very thickly slice the flesh. Toss into the oil mixture with the basil and potatoes, adding any juice from the peppers, then pile onto a large platter with the rocket. Flake the salmon on top in chunky pieces and scatter with the pine nuts. Serve with crusty bread to mop up the juices.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 575 calories, Fat 33 grams fat, SaturatedFat 5 grams saturated fat, Carbohydrate 35 grams carbohydrates, Sugar 15 grams sugar, Fiber 5 grams fiber, Protein 37 grams protein, Sodium 2.7 milligram of sodium
